#da756b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da756b is composed of 85.5% red, 45.9%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 5.4 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 63.7%. #da756b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ffead6 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#da756b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da756b has RGB values of R:218, G:117,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.51,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14316907.

Shades and Tints of #da756b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090302 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#da756b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89e9d is the less saturated color, while #fe5847 is the most saturated one.
